Graduation from high school, or equivalent.

Three (3) years of full-time experience performing responsible clerical duties involving contact with the public and providing extensive customer service.

Proficiency in keyboarding sufficient to type 45 net words per minute.

Must pass a nationwide fingerprint-based record check, and a wants/warrants check.

Must complete Security Awareness and National Crime Information Center (NCIC)/Nevada Criminal Justice Information System (NCJIS) certification within six months of hire/transfer and be recertified every two years. Must maintain certifications in NCIC/NCJIS as a condition of continued employment.

Desirable: Two (2) years of full-time clerical experience in a legal setting or criminal justice agency.

Desirable: College coursework in criminal justice.

Desirable: Bi-lingual proficiency in verbal and written communications.

Some candidates may be disqualified indefinitely due to the results of their background investigation.City of Henderson, NevadaTeamsters Contract Benefits SummaryHEALTHCARE AND INSURANCE

Health Insurance: Medical, Prescription, Dental, Vision through Teamsters Local #14 Health Trust

Medical Benefit Allowance to offset monthly insurance premium to a $0 Out-of-Pocket Cost

Employer paid Long Term Disability – Up to 60% of Base Wage If Approved

Employer paid Term Life Insurance / AD&D - $50,000 Life Insurance on employee

Health Trust paid Life Insurance - $25,000 for Employee and $10,000 for active Dependents

Employee Assistance Program – 8 Free Visits for Employee and Family Members in the Household

Medicare – Employee and City each pay 1.45%

RETIREMENT

Employer paid membership in the Nevada Public Employees Retirement System (PERS)

No Social Security tax on employee's wages

Retirement Health Savings (RHS) program – Employer contribution of 1.7% of base wage

PAID LEAVEVACATION

Employee credited with 19 hours of annual leave at the end of the first six (6) months of employment. Annual leave will accrue from month 7 to month 12 at 3.167 hours per month (total 38 hours first year of employment).

Accrued at 9.5 hours per month after first year through fifth year; 12.67 hours per month sixth through twelfth year; 15.83 hours per month upon completion of twelfth year and beyond

SICK LEAVE

Accrued at 9.5 hours per month from date of hire

BEREAVEMENT LEAVE

Three consecutive days of leave, with pay, per occurrence, to attend funeral for immediate family member; increased to one work week when funeral is held 400 statute miles or more from City of Henderson

HOLIDAYS

13 paid holidays per year

Two (2) floating holidays per year

The ability to bank holidays, up to 228 hours, that fall on an employee’s regularly scheduled day off

WORK WEEK

Four-day, 9.5-hour workday, 38-hour work week

Three-day, 12-hour workday, 38-hour work week for certain positions

UNIFORM ALLOWANCE

Uniform Allowance - $85.00 per month to employees required to wear a uniform, or $115.00 if required to wear fire retardant clothing

A $175.00 shoe allowance is provided on an annual basis to those employees required to wear ANSI Z41-1991 or above rated safety shoes
